AI-Generated Summary

This episode of *Financially Confident Christian* tackles the emotional cycle of spending driven by stress, particularly during high-pressure times like May, which the host calls the 'May Squeeze.' The guest's voicemail reveals a common struggle: using money as a temporary fix for emotional overwhelm, only to feel worse afterward. Host Ralphie Step Jr. reframes emotional spending not as a money problem, but as a symptom of unmet emotional needs. He emphasizes that the real issue is the lack of healthy coping mechanisms. The solution lies in creating intentional pauses before spending, identifying emotional triggers, and replacing impulsive purchases with restorative practices like prayer, journaling, walking, or calling a trusted friend. Practical steps include removing easy access to credit cards and shopping apps, building friction into the spending process, and anchoring peace in God rather than consumption. The episode closes with a powerful call to action: write a personal pause rule and trust in God’s sustaining presence, as highlighted in Psalm 55:22.

Key Takeaways
1

Emotional spending is a response to pressure, not a money problem—identify your triggers first.

2

Build a 5–10 minute pause before spending to break the impulse cycle.

3

Replace spending with restorative habits like prayer, walking, journaling, or calling a trusted person.

4

Remove friction from spending by deleting shopping apps and removing saved payment info.

5

Anchor your peace in God, not in consumption—He offers lasting relief without cost.
